As suggested by the "________ hypothesis," the cessation of the menstrual cycle while a female is at full physical capacity allo
RoseWind [281]

Answer:

Grandmother hypothesis

Explanation:

The grandmother hypothesis is the result of a further developed mother hypothesis. The mother hypothesis suggests that the energy required to keep a woman fertile is better used in order to ensure that her offspring reproduce.

The grandmother hypothesis suggests that the grandmothers bolster the efforts of the mothers and make sure that their grandchildren's genetic interests are met. The grandmothers' can also increase the grandchild's social circle further increasing their chance to mate.
